The relationship with a sibling is one of the longest in a person’s life often longer than the relationship with a parent, spouse, or best friend. Written from the sibling’s perspective, this compilation of stories celebrates the joys and challenges of having a sibling with Down syndrome. As people with Down syndrome live longer, fuller lives, their siblings take on the important task of providing care, support, and love. It is a difficult job, and one we did not ask for but we wouldn’t trade it for anything. The stories in this book are written by siblings who believe in faith, hope, and unconditional love that redefine what it means to be a family.
